A Buckinghamshire-based Chartered Quantity Surveying consultancy is seeking a bright Assistant Quantity Surveyor after securing a variety of new projects.

The successful Assistant Quantity Surveyor will join a close-knit Quantity Surveying team, assisting on a diverse range of projects including hotels, student accommodation, and cladding remediation schemes. This is an ideal opportunity for a Graduate Quantity Surveyor or Assistant Quantity Surveyor with 12+ months QS experience to gain valuable pre and post contract experience, increased site exposure and structured APC support.
